This release also touts smoother video playback, due to “changes made to priority, to ensure that video gets the most attention from the CPU/GPU for smoothest-possible playback.” Keen to be as great at collating and browser music as it is video, Kodi 18 adds better filtering options, the ability to sort by artist name, and ‘enhanced artwork’. For the genuine experience as well, we’ve also introduced support for joysticks, gamepads, and other platform-specific controls, so the games will work just as was intended,” Kodi say.Įlsewhere, the tool also sports a vastly improved Music Library experience. “ now have a whole world of retro gaming at your fingertips, all from the same interface as your movies, music and TV shows. Kodi 18 supports gaming emulators, ROM files, and control pads like the nifty ones from 8BitDo. Yes, the same Kodi media center you use to watch your movies and TV shows can now double up as your own personal arcade. Kodi 18 (codename “Leia”) sees the open-source and cross-platform media tool add a number of new strings to its already well-strung bow. You now have a whole world of retro gaming at your fingertips
